The paper deals with the problem of approximating plane curves in the sense that an approximation operator (for instance trigonometric polynomial expansion) is applied to a class of parametric representations of a given curve and the parametrization is to be chosen such as to minimize the deviation from the curve in the sense of some metric. A rather general iterative scheme is given to determine satisfactory parametrizations. Applications to coding of information in television systems are discussed and examples illustrate the usefulness of the approach.
